Page views for the Best Use of Photography winners are not yet available, because those entries are not submitted in digital form. However, a list of winners is available:
Best Use of Photography by Newspapers with less than 75,000 circulation
- 1st
- The Herald
- 2nd
- Concord Monitor
- 3rd
- Midland Daily News
- HM
- Naples Daily News
Best Use of Photography by Newspapers with circulation 75,000 and over
- 1st
- The New York Times
- 2nd
- Seattle Post-Intelligencer
- 3rd
- Commercial Appeal
- HM
- Denver Post
Best Use of Photography by Magazines
- 1st
- Newsweek

- Multi-page news
A multi-page presentation of a news event from within a single news cycle.
Each entry must be a single PDF file.
- Single-page News
A single page presentation, other than a section front, of news from within a single news cycle.
- Newspaper Picture Editor of the Year – INDIVIDUAL
A portfolio of no more than 10 (PDF) entries from the Newspaper Picture Editing categories. Judges will consider range and diversity of entrant’s portfolio.
The entry must be submitted as a single PDF file containing the entire portfolio.
- Newspaper Picture Editor of the Year – TEAM
A portfolio of 10 (PDF) entries from the Newspaper Picture Editing categories. Judges will consider range and diversity of entrants’ portfolio.
The entry must be submitted as a single PDF file containing the entire portfolio.
- Newspaper Recurring Feature or Series
Submit four separate examples from the feature or series.
This category is intended for photo columns, personality profile series, or similar presentations.
Each entry must be a single PDF file containing all four examples.
- Newspaper Special Section or Reprint
A special section presentation or reprint. Not a normal section of the paper.
Each entry must be a single PDF file.
- Newspaper Illustrative multiple page
A multiple page presentation of food, fashion, natural history, science or technology, or related topics. The expectation is that the images are illustrative or essay oriented. Feature stories should be entered in EN06.
Each entry must be a single PDF file.
- Newspaper Illustrative single page
A single page presentation of food, fashion, natural history, science or technology, or related topics. The expectation is that the images are illustrative or essay oriented. Feature pages should be entered in EN05.
- Multiple-page Newspaper Documentary/Photojournalism project
A multiple-page presentation of a photojournalistic or documentary project. Breaking news coverage should be entered in EN13 or EN14.
Each entry must be a single PDF file.
- Single-page Newspaper Documentary/Photojournalism project
A single-page presentation of a photojournalistic or documentary project. Breaking news coverage should be entered in EN13 or EN14.
- Newspaper Sports project
One or more pages. Single-page entries that ran as the front page should be entered in EN03.
Each entry must be a single PDF file.
- Newspaper Sports Section Front
The front page from the Sports section. Interior pages should be entered in EN04.
- Newspaper News section front other than front page
A news section front other than the front page. Usually a local, regional, or metro section front.
- Newspaper Front page
The front page of the newspaper.

- Magazine Picture Editor of the Year
A portfolio of no more than 10 complete entries from the above listed Magazine Picture Editing categories. Judges will consider range and diversity of entrant’s portfolio.
The entire portfolio must be saved as a single PDF file.
- Magazine Personality Profile or Lifestyle Story
Entries may consist of single or multiple pages.
Each entry must be a single PDF file.
- Magazine Recurring Feature or Series
Submit 4 examples of the series or feature.
Each entry must be a single PDF file containing the four examples.
- Magazine Sports Story
Entries may consist of single or multiple pages.
Each entry must be a single PDF file.
- Magazine Illustrative Story
A non-news story about food, fashion, natural history, science/technology, or similar topics. The expectation is that the images are illustrative or essay oriented.
- Magazine Story Opener
Entries may be presented as a single page, two-page spread (double truck), gatefold or double gatefold.
Each entry must be a single PDF file.
- Magazine News Story
A story based on a news event. Single, or multiple pages.
Each entry must be a single PDF file.
- Magazine Cover
The cover of a magazine.
